Which Hitch for a 2004 Chevy S-10 and What is Involved in Installing
Question:
I want to install a step bumper hitch on a 2004 chev s 10 , what hitch should i use and what is involved i the installation.
asked by: Bill
0
Expert Reply:
If your Chevy S-10 has a step bumper then I would go with hitch # 75085. This has a 2 inch square receiver opening which allows you to use the most accessories (bike racks, cargo carriers, etc.). There is a link to the installation instructions so you can see what is involved in the installation.
